将单个大型Google云端硬盘归档文件导入共享的Google Colab项目

时间:2019-10-10 19:16:54

标签: machine-learning google-drive-api google-colaboratory

我正在一个班级项目中,我们正在使用Google Colabs中的大型数据集。值得注意的是,如果运行时断开连接,则不会保存文件。因此,我将数据集下载到了我的个人驱动器中,但是正努力使Colabs项目可以访问它。我也不能只挂载我的驱动器,因为还有其他人正在为此工作。

是否可以通过某种方式在Colabs中下载驱动器文件上的链接共享?

保存训练好的模型的方法也很有用,但是共享模型和保存文件的问题仍然存在。

1 个答案:

答案 0 :(得分:1)

我知道2种方法。

如果您只想与您的朋友分享,而不是公开,则可以通过Google Drive分享。每个朋友都需要auth.authenticate_user(),然后使用pydrive来加载FILE_ID给定的文件。

如果您可以将其公开,则更加容易。任何人都可以使用

下载文件
!gdown --id xxxxxxxxx

xxxxxxx是FILE_ID。